The Anti-Toxoplasma Antibody IgM Test offers fast, accurate detection of acute toxoplasmosis by identifying IgM antibodies specific to Toxoplasma gondii. Designed for early diagnosis, it enables timely treatment and reduces the risk of complications, especially in pregnant women and immunocompromised individuals.

Anti-Transglutaminase IgA is a highly sensitive and specific serological test for diagnosing celiac disease. It detects IgA antibodies against tissue transglutaminase (tTG), a key marker of gluten intolerance.

Anti-Varicella Zoster Antibodies, IgG is a high-quality immunoassay reagent designed for the precise detection of IgG antibodies against the Varicella-Zoster Virus (VZV). It enables accurate diagnosis of past infections, immunity status, and vaccine response.
